Shirts Thief Jailed - Ipswich Town News
Jamie Underwood, the man who stole shirts and other memorabilia from the statue of Sir Bobby Robson, was jailed for eight weeks by magistrates earlier today.
Underwood, 21, admitted the thefts to magistrates last month, telling the court that he was drunk at the time of the incident and couldn’t remember stealing the shirts, scarves and other memorabilia placed by the statue as tributes to the legendary Town manager in the weeks after his death.
